21xrx.com
2024-09-20 00:15:34 Friday
登录
文章检索 我的文章 写文章
C++ 和 MATLAB 的应用及比较分析
2023-06-28 10:37:43 深夜i     --     --
C++ MATLAB 应用 比较分析 编程语言

C++和MATLAB是两种常用的计算机编程语言,它们在不同领域中有许多应用。本文将分析它们的应用和比较。

1. 应用:C++和MATLAB

C++是一种高级编程语言,广泛用于硬件或操作系统等底层的开发。它比较灵活,能够实现底层操作和高效的计算,适合开发较大规模的系统和程序。例如,游戏开发、操作系统、嵌入式开发等领域中广泛应用。

MATLAB则是一种数学软件,主要用于数学、工程和科学等领域。它具有强大的矩阵运算和图形绘制功能,适合进行科学计算、数据分析、信号处理等方面的工作。例如,金融分析、机器学习、图像处理等领域中广泛应用。

2. 比较分析:C++和MATLAB

C++相较于MATLAB,更加底层,能够完成任何计算机可以完成的工作。它可以充分利用计算机的硬件和系统资源,执行速度快。但是使用C++开发需要具备较高的技能水平,并需要花费更长的时间和精力。

MATLAB则是一种更高级别的编程语言,更加简单易用。使用MATLAB编程可以有效地降低开发难度,并且其强大的矩阵运算和图形绘制功能能够方便地完成统计分析和绘图等工作。但是,MATLAB的执行速度较慢,对于大量的数据处理和数字计算,可能需要较多的时间,对于大规模科学计算的要求较高的场合,就不适合使用MATLAB。

3. 结论

针对不同的需求和场景,选择C++或MATLAB都有自身的优缺点。C++在底层开发、系统开发等领域有着广泛的应用,MATLAB则适合进行科学计算和数据分析等任务。因此,在开发前需要明确需求,并根据需求选择适合的编程语言,以提高开发效率和执行效率。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复